PEtALS : ESB open source
Lorsque j’ai ouvert mon blog, une personne est venue me contacter pour m’encourager à continuer, car en effet le plus dur est de perdurer dans l’écriture d’articles… Enfin bref, là n’est pas le sujet de ce post.
La personne en question fait partis d’une société éditrice d’un ESB open source : PEtALS (ebm websourcing). Après avoir étudié quelques EBS open source (Mule, Service Mix, …) je me suis dis, encore un projet open source qui implémente simplement les spécifications JSR 208 (JBI).
Eh bien j’avais tord, car PEtALS est un projet dont on n’imagine pas le potentiel au premier abord. Non seulement PEtALS propose une architecture compléte pour l’intégration d’applications, mais en plus innove dans le domaine des architectures orientées services. En effet PEtALS permet la mise en place d’architectures orientées composants (SCA).
La distribution PEtALS propose un conteneur JBI ainsi qu’une interface d’administration via le navigateur. Elle intègre également un annuaire de web services (jUDDI).
Pour un exemple complet de l’utilisation de PEtALS, vous pouvez aller voir l’article écris par Adrien Louis sur Java World où il met en place une architecture SOA à partir de service Web existant.
Je vous conseil également d’aller sur le site d’OW2 où une présentation complète du projet est réalisée : http://petals.objectweb.org/.
admin @ juin 23, 2008
Ravi de voir que le soft t’aie plu
Je n’ai malheureusement pas eu la possibilité de le tester dans son intégralité, mais j’ai lu pas mal de doc et j’ai lancé les samples fournis avec la distribution complète et je suis vraiment surpris par la solution.
En plus de ça, le projet a été intégré dans les softs du consortium OW2, cela veut tout simplement dire qu’il est très puissant.
Merci pour cette découverte